WebThe amount of commission that Camp America take out of your pay if exploitative. I earnt 96 cent an hour, $900 for the whole summer, while my American colleagues earnt $4000. It would be better to apply to a camp directly. We are a full-service cultural exchange summer camp staffing resource. Camps participate knowing that we facilitate quality application and interview processes as well as J-1 visas, insurance, interviews and program support for our participants.
